Location

Triberg is located in the heart of the Black Forest and lies at an altitude of 700-1,000 metres. Here you find Germany’s highest waterfalls, which provide a spectacular sight. The 17th-century Baroque church "Maria in der Tann" is also well worth a visit, as is the town hall with its beautiful wooden hall. Marvel at the historic Black Forest farms within the Black Forest Museum, or visit the world’s largest cuckoo clock in the Eble Uhrenpark.

A network of well-marked hiking trails invites you to go hiking, cycling or Nordic walking in the summer, and skiing or tobogganing in the winter.

The beautiful city of Freiburg and the leisure park "Europa-Park Rust" can be reached by car from here in just one hour.

Stayed here for 2 nights to break a long drive from Austria to UK and to sample the Black Forest. Reception isn't manned a lot of the time but somebody comes quickly if you ring the bell. Our welcome was entirely in German which was good practice and concentrated the mind. The staff understand English but stay in German until you surrender. And why not? Parking is secure and off-road on 2 underground floors. The room was spacious with a large balcony and a view over the town. The bathroom was large too although the shower had the strangest shaped head on it. Fine for washing a car but easy to wet the whole floor as well. Amusingly there was a water meter on the wall so you can see how much water you're using. Very green. Restaurant downstairs had unadventurous standard menu but the food was of high quality and reasonably priced. Continental breakfast was fine, although the cooked offerings looked congealed and greasy. Overall a very pleasant stay. It is worth noting that the town centre (and famous waterfall) is about half a mile away downhill. To return to the hotel from almost anywhere you will have a significant uphill walk, so maybe you might not want to do it too many times in a day,
